Restaurant Details: Benihana is San Diego’s favorite traditional Japanese steakhouse. Every night is a celebration, sizzling with music, laughter, and thunderous applause. A unique experience, where food is "not only cooked, it’s choreographed", Benihana features extraordinarily talented chefs who slice and cook your meal’s ingredients at a hibachi table right in front of you. Awe-inspiring knife shows and stand-up comedy are characteristic, and eating out has never been more entertaining. Besides typical teppanyaki selections such as chicken breast, shrimp, steak, calamari, scallops, salmon and vegetables, Benihana also offers delicious sushi rolls, and tasty desserts—try the banana tempura with strawberry ice cream. The bar’s enticing cocktails will only make you clap louder.

Editorial Review of Benihana of Tokyo

Although Benihana has become an international brand, they celebrate their Japanese heritage as the most important part of “experiencing” the Benihana by honoring one of the oldest cultures on earth in the way they display themselves and serve their guests. At the core of the Benihana experience is the teppanyaki table, where guests are able to gather and enjoy a meal skillfully prepared and cooked to excellence on a steel grill, right in front of their eyes — by a chef who more than just a culinary master, but an entertainer. The meal begins with a fine Japanese onion soup, which is followed by a salad with the well known ginger dressing. The chef then uses the sizzling grill surface to prepare your chicken, beef or seafood, along with vegetables, hibachi-style. It’s a show you’ll sure enjoy because Benihana chefs literally play with your food as they cook it. Your entrée will be served with family dipping sauces and steamed rice. If you rather, there’s also the option of Benihana's mouthwatering Hibachi chicken rice. There is also the option of ordering tempura, sushi and specialty rolls.
